Fixing a Minor Dent

For minor dents, you can try the following methods:

1. Aluminum foil and compressed air/hairdryer: Place a piece of aluminum foil over the dent and heat it using compressed air or a hairdryer. The sudden change in temperature can cause the dent to pop out.

2. Boiling water: Boil a pot of water and pour it over the dent. The heat will cause the metal to expand, allowing the dent to pop out. Use a plunger to push the dent from the inside if necessary.

3. Plunger: Apply a generous amount of water or lubricant to the dent and use a plunger to create suction. Pull the plunger forcefully to pop out the dent.

Repairing a Larger Dent

For larger dents, follow these steps:

1. Rubber mallet and wooden block: Place a wooden block on the inside of the door, directly behind the dent. Use a rubber mallet to gently tap the dent from the outside. Gradually increase the force until the dent is pushed out.

2. Auto body filler: Clean the dent and surrounding area thoroughly. Mix the auto body filler according to the manufacturer’s instructions and apply it to the dent. Use a putty knife to spread the filler evenly and let it dry completely.

3. Sanding and painting: Once the filler is dry, use sandpaper to smooth out any rough edges. Prime the repaired area and apply a fresh coat of paint that matches the color of your garage door.
